About The Position

The Client Services Coordinator I is responsible for the daily management of assigned portfolios, including all new and outstanding relationships. This role serves as the primary contact for existing clients and supports the commercial, business banking, and private banking departments. The position requires effective communication, administrative support, and a strong understanding of banking procedures and loan documentation.

Responsibilities

  • Daily management of assigned portfolios including all new and outstanding relationships.
  • Serve as primary contact for existing clients.
  • Answer phones and greet customers.
  • Communicate effectively with customers, internal and external, either verbally or in writing.
  • Assist customers with all transactional needs between accounts, to include, but not limited to, account transfers and wire requests.
  • Partner with all business lines to service customer’s banking needs, such as opening accounts and account maintenance.
  • Identify any cross-selling opportunities.
  • Assist in the preparation, maintenance, and servicing of loans, which includes ordering any supporting documentation from outside service providers.
  • Create customer profiles in lending software and assist in preparation of approval document.
  • Determine appropriate approval authorities required for all loan requests.
  • Ensure all documents are accurate and ready for closing.
  • Close loans in lender’s absence.
  • Fund loans according to documentation within the loan package.
  • Submit closed loans for processing in a timely manner.
  • Manage all exception reports by notifying clients, vendors, or lenders of needed documentation.
  • Submit required, collected financial statements to Credit Analysts for processing.
  • Provide administrative support to the department as needed.
